Background Image
◀ Show more nearby results for Podiatrists

ALPINE FOOT SPECIALISTS PC

Category: Podiatrists

765 Ela Rd Ste 100
Lake Zurich, IL 60047


COMPANY DESCRIPTION:


ALPINE FOOT SPECIALISTS PC is categorized under PODIATRISTS and located at 765 Ela Rd Ste 100 60047 in or near the Lake Zurich, IL area. Find additional information including website, email, map, and directions - alpinefootspecialists.com.  Find additional PODIATRISTS at MedicalYP.com ®.


Ready to advertise and become a part of our network?

Click here for advertising information on The Original YP Network®